‘Monday Night Wars’ edition of WWE 2K26 announced

Another version of WWE 2K26 has been announced.

Following the Attitude Era edition trailer that premiered on Friday’s SmackDown, a Monday Night Wars edition of the upcoming video game was revealed during Saturday Night’s Main Event. Both editions of the game will be avaliable to pre-order starting on January 30.

The trailer shown on Saturday features familiar clips from the Monday Night Wars that took place between WWE and WCW from 1995 through WCW’s purchase in 2001 including the rise of the nWo, D-Generation X, Goldberg, The Rock, and Stone Cold Steve Austin. Details on what either version of the game will include has yet to be announced.

Cover wrestlers include Austin, Rock, Undertaker, Triple H, Kurt Angle, and Chyna on one side with Hulk Hogan, Kevin Nash, Scott Hall, Goldberg, Booker T, and Eric Bischoff on the other.

Not many details have been announced so far for 2K26. A commercial was taped last month that will air in the coming weeks, and it was reported earlier this month that this year’s Showcase Mode will center on CM Punk, including ‘what if’ scenarios.
